Cognitive behavioural therapy, CBT, has its origin in learning psychology and is evidence based. The research and theory formation comes from foremost learning psychology, cognitive psychology and social psychology.
CBT is usually described as a short term therapy and lasts between 10-20 sessions. As CBT places an emphasis on helping you as a client learn to be your own therapist you will work with exercises in the session as well as “homework” exercises outside of sessions. The work is usually very structured and the therapist makes sure you continue to work towards your goals and follow up your progress along the way. Towards the end of the therapy you will work out a plan how you will continue to work with your wellbeing after the sessions have ended and if needed regular booster sessions are booked.
